BC Kush is a legendary cannabis strain with roots in the stunning landscape of British Columbia, Canada. Known for its impressive potency and pure indica characteristics, it offers a classic experience appreciated by cannabis lovers around the world. Its genetics promise a relaxing and calming effect, making it an ideal choice for evenings or late hours when relaxation is the top priority.

Effect

The effect of BC Kush is deeply relaxing and can induce a strong physical sedation, ideal for relieving pain, stress, and insomnia. Its highly sedative effects make it perfect for users seeking an escape from hectic daily life or needing help falling asleep. Its effects set in quickly and leave a feeling of contentment and calm that lasts for a long time.

Taste/smell

BC Kush exudes an earthy and piney aroma with a hint of sweetness that will immediately appeal to cannabis connoisseurs. When smoked or vaped, a complex aroma unfolds, offering notes of spice, wood, and sometimes even a light citrus undertone. The taste remains true to its aroma, offering smokers a rich and satisfying experience.

THC content

The THC content in BC Kush can vary greatly, but typically ranges between approximately 18% and 22%, making it a potent strain that should be enjoyed with caution, especially by beginners or those with low tolerance. Its potent effects make it a preferred choice for many medicinal purposes, as well as for recreational users seeking profound relaxation.

Cultivation

BC Kush is known for its relative ease of cultivation, making it a great choice for both experienced growers and beginners. It performs equally well indoors and outdoors, although its mountainous origins suggest it prefers cooler temperatures. This plant typically flowers within 8 to 9 weeks and, with proper care and optimal conditions, can produce bountiful harvests. Its resistance to mold and pests makes it a robust and reliable choice for a variety of growing environments.
